WebOHSS can occur when the ovaries are over stimulated with fertility medication used in IVF or other fertility treatments. Typically, OHSS symptoms are minor, with mild to moderate pain, loss of appetite and feeling bloated. Careful monitoring, decreased activity, pain medicine and drinking lots of water are recommended for patients diagnosed ... WebDay 1 – After the embryos are transferred, the cells keep dividing.
